Dungannon Swifts 0-4 Drogheda United
Updated: Monday, 14 Apr 2008 23:18
Setanta Sports Cup holders Drogheda United sent a clear message of intent to their rivals in this year’s competition after recording an impressive 4-0 victory against a thoroughly outclassed Dungannon Swifts side.
Tony Grant got the ball rolling for the Premier Division champions after just four minutes when he fired past Dwayne Nelson in the Dungannon goal.
Graham Gartland added a second on 35 minutes when he headed home a cross from the left wing.
The Swifts rallied after the restart, but an Adam McMinn own goal after 63 minutes ended the tie as a contest.
Declan O’Brien added to the hosts’ woes with a superb fourth for a rampant Drogs outfit five minutes from time.
Dungannon Swifts: Nelson, Fitzpatrick, Curran, McMinn, Gallagher, McConkey, McCarron, Hegarty, Tomelty, Murphy, McAllister.
Substitutes: Friel for McCarron, Ferry for Gallagher, McGerrigan for McAllister
Drogheda United: Ewings, Shelley, Gavin, Gartland, Cahill, Baker, Keegan, Hughes, Kendrick, Grant, O’Keefe.
Substitutes: Byrne for Gavin, O’Brien for O’Keefe, Barrett for Grant
Referee: B Turkington.
